Well, it looks like the high water temperature finally got rid of the Ich, at least the visible stage of the parasite. My fish are all fine, and look happy and healthy once again.
Because there was a little bit of "cross over" from tank to tank, I treated both -the 30 g and the new 75 g. (this will not happen again since now I have an extra 10g to use as quarantine tank). I'll keep the Temp at 85-86 for 2 more weeks, as recommended.
The question is, Can I start moving my fish from the 30g to the 75g? Or should i wait 2 more weeks until all risk of Ich is gone?
The only fish affected withthe parasite were some of the rummy nose and two serpae tetra. None of the other guys got it so far.
